Quantum graph isomorphism–strategy correspondence conjecture

Let G:XXG:X\to X and H:AAH:A\to A be irreflexive quantum graphs. The quantum graph isomorphism game is

λGH:XXopAAop,\lambda_{G\simeq H}:X\otimes X^\mathrm{op}\to A\otimes A^\mathrm{op},

with

λGH:=λGHλHG.\lambda_{G\simeq H}:=\lambda_{G\to H}\star\lambda_{H\to G}^\dagger.

A quantum graph isomorphism from GG to HH is the corresponding structure-preserving quantum map. Quantum graph isomorphism–strategy correspondence conjecture. There is a one-to-one correspondence between quantum graph isomorphisms from GG to HH and quantum tensor bistrategies realizing perfect bicorrelations, with respect to a cup state, for the quantum graph isomorphism game λGH\lambda_{G\simeq H}. The theorem preceding this conjecture establishes bisynchronicity, constructs perfect bicorrelations from quantum graph isomorphisms using quantum bistrategies and a cup state, and obtains quantum graph isomorphisms from perfect quantum commuting bistrategies; the full tensor-strategy correspondence remains unproved.
